Zac Posen is a renowned American fashion designer, creative director, and television personality. Born in the United States in 1980, this talented individual has made a lasting impact on the fashion industry. With a career spanning over two decades, Posen has achieved remarkable success, including roles such as Creative Director for Brooks Brothers from 2014 to 2020 and more recently, as the creative director of Gap and chief creative officer of Old Navy since February 2024. As a testament to his skill and creativity, Posen has designed for various platforms, including bridal gowns and uniforms for prominent brands. His work has been recognized globally, solidifying his position as a leading figure in the fashion world.

| Biography Aspect | Details |
|---|---|
| Full Name | Zac Posen |
| Date of Birth | 1980 |
| Place of Birth | United States |
| Nationality | American |
| Occupation | Fashion Designer, Creative Director, Television Personality |
| Notable Works / Achievements | Designed bridal gowns for David’s Bridal, uniforms for Delta Air Lines, and a blush silk gown for Princess Eugenie of York’s evening wedding reception |
| Career Highlights | Creative Director for Brooks Brothers (2014-2020), creative director of Gap and chief creative officer of Old Navy (since February 2024) |
